Title:
RADIO WAVE ABSORBER

Abstract:

PURPOSE: To reduce weight and to increase a frequency range by converting incident radio wave into a current, consuming it as heat, and shielding the opposite radio wave to the incident radio wave.

CONSTITUTION: An element 1 made of a current converter, i.e., a flat platelike conductor for converting radio wave into a current is disposed perpendicularly to an electric field E. Even if the conductor is disposed perpendicularly to the electric field E in this manner, a magnetic field is not disordered at all. Accordingly, the way of propagating the radio wave does not change before entering the element 1 or after entering it, and similar propagating state is obtained. A resistor R is disposed between a current converter 1a and a shielding element 1b. The resistor R is of a thermal converter 2, which converts the current from the element 1a to heat to consume it. A space is formed of the element 1a, the converter 2 and the element 1b, and air or nonconductive material is filled in the space. For example, a glass plate is employed as filler, i.e., supporting element 5, and the element 1a of metal thin film formed by depositing metal such as chromium or the like is provided on its rear face.
